Burst Pipe Water Damage in Brentwood, TN

Shut the main first. It is usually at the meter or where the service line enters the building, and every minute it stays open is another twenty gallons into your floor.

A burst supply line is clean water, category 1 under the IICRC standard, and that is the best news you will get all day. Clean water means most materials can be dried rather than removed, provided the drying starts fast. After about 48 hours category 1 degrades toward category 2 as it sits in building materials and picks up contaminants.

Green Property Restoration crews reach Brentwood, TN properties within hours. Standing water comes out first, then we pull moisture readings from framing, subfloor and drywall to map how far the water actually traveled. It is almost always further than the visible wet patch.

Frozen pipe bursts get an extra step. We identify why that section froze, because an uninsulated run in an exterior wall will do it again next winter.

How it works

From your call to a dry building

01

Call and stabilize

We tell you where to shut the water off while the crew is dispatched.

02

Extract and assess

Standing water out, then moisture readings mapped through framing and subfloor.

03

Dry and monitor

Equipment set and checked daily until materials read normal, usually 3 to 5 days.

04

Document and repair

Readings and photos go to your adjuster, then repairs put the building back.

What are IICRC category 1 2 and 3 water?
Category 1 water is clean, category 2 is gray, and category 3 is black and highly contaminated. We follow IICRC standards for each type.
What equipment is used for drying?
We use air movers and LGR dehumidifiers along with moisture meters and thermal cameras. This equipment removes water and prevents secondary damage.
